Output 21f21fd375083704765d303ab040e481b99145489cd59201439a1e715a767577:5

value
37180048
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3b10826e61f1580337af3b4a191d3b79dfdb55d OP_EQUAL
address
3LzLaQd7MaoWX4NmzGGdmKcKHDZBgweBmF
transaction
21f21fd375083704765d303ab040e481b99145489cd59201439a1e715a767577
spent
true